Stimulating interest through exploration

Health Sciences have an excellent reputation in the region for giving opportunities to young people to spark a passion for discovery and inspire a lifelong interest in health and social care.

We spread the message about the rewarding careers in healthcare to schools and colleges in Southampton, Portsmouth, Hampshire and the Isle of Wight, by visiting careers fairs and inviting young people to come and see our impressive facilities for themselves.

Find out more about nursing and midwifery?

Health sciences hold open sessions for those interested in nursing and midwifery courses throughout the year and are a good opportunity to ask questions to staff and students. They are run as an informal drop in so no booking is necessary.

Discover together at the University Science Day

Find out how the human body works, how to have a baby and your genetic make up.The University’s annual Science and Engineering Day is a great opportunity for families to learn together and share their discoveries.
